The Freehold Twp. Little League is honored to host the Junior League Eastern Regional Tournament for it's 5th straight year. State Champions from Maine to Maryland will participate in the double elimination tournament with the dream of earning a berth to the Junior League World Series in Taylor, Michigan.

The tournament will kick-off with a banquet for the teams & guests on Friday, August 7 at 6:30 PM. The opening ceremony & parade of teams will be held on Saturday, August 8 at 9 AM. The games will be held daily at Michael J. Tighe Park (formerly Liberty Oak Park) Field #7 in Freehold, NJ on Saturday thru Monday: 10 AM, 1 PM, 4 PM & 7 PM; Tuesday: 1 PM, 4 PM & 7 PM; Wednesday: 4 PM & 7 PM; & Thursday: 11 AM & 2 PM (if necessary).

Teams will receive information packets regarding the tournament, official hotels (room blocks & discounted rates), and the banquet. Parents are encouraged to contact their team representative to obtain information on the discount room blocks & the banquet.

~ The Teams ~
2009 State Champions & Host

Connecticut: North End LL, Bridgeport CT (5-0)

North End went 3-0 in Sectional play outscoring opponents 32-8 and then won 2 straight games, including an 18-1 victory, to win the State Championship. The Connecticut State Champs will play their first game on August 8 against the New Jersey State Champs from Holbrook LL.

Delaware:  Camden-Wyoming LL, Camden DE (7-0)

Camden-Wyoming went undefeated in the District & State tournaments winning 4 of the 7 games by a margin of 10 or more runs. The Delaware State Champs will play their first game on August 8 against the Pennsylvania State Champs from Carlisle Area LL.

Maine: Bangor Westside/East Little League, Bangor ME (8-1)

Bangor Westside/East LL will be making it's forth consecutive trip to the Regional's & sixth since 2001. After going 4-0 in the Districts, they lost their first State tournament game and bounced back to win 4 games in 3 days including a come fram behind victory in the 'if' game to capture the state title. The Maine State Champs will play their first game against the Maryland State Champs from Thurmont LL on August 8 in the nightcap.

Maryland: Thurmont Little League, Thurmont MD (6-1)

Thurmont LL went undefeated in District play, and into the States before losing the championship game and bouncing back to win the State Championship. The Maryland State Champs will play their first game against the Maine State Champs from Bangor Westside/East LL on August 8 in the nightcap.

Massachusetts: Quincy Little League, Quincy MA (10-2)

Quincy LL will make their first visit to the Regional's. After going undefeated in District play, Quincy had to climb out of the loser's bracket in both the Section & State Tournaments to capture the State title. On the way they had to win 3 important games in less than 24 hours. The Massachusetts State Champs will play the winner of the Connecticut/New Jersey game on August 9.

New Jersey: Holbrook LL, Jackson NJ (10-1)

Holbrook LL went undefeated in Section & State Tournament play outscoring their opponents 47-5 in those 5 games. The New Jersey State Champs will play the Connecticut State Champs from North End LL on August 8.

NJ District 19 Host: Freehold Twp. LL, Freehold NJ (4-0)

Freehold Twp. LL makes it's second consecutive appearance in the Regional's after winning all 4 games by a margin of 39-2 to capture the District 19 Championship. The NJ District 19 Host Champs will open the Regional's against the Rhode Island State Champs from Rumford LL on August 8.

New York: North Bellmore/North Merrick LL, N. Bellmore/N. Merrick NY (12-1)

The New York State Champs from North Bellmore/North Merrick will play their first game against the winner of the District 19 Host/Rhode Island game on August 9.

Pennsylvania: Carlisle Area LL, Carlisle PA (14-1)

Carlisle will be making their first trip to the Regional's at any level. During their tournament drive they outscored their opponents 143-39. The Pennsylvania State Champs will play their first game on August 8 against the Delaware State Champs from Camden-Wyoming LL.

Rhode Island: Rumford LL, Rumford RI (7-2)

This is Rumford LL's first State title in their 58 year history. After winning the District Tournament, they lost in the first round of states before mounting an exciting comeback which started with 10 inning victory over the defending state champions in the losers bracket final. Rumford then avenged their first loss by beating that team twice in the finals to capture the state crown. The Rhode Island State Champs will open the Regional's against Freehold Twp. LL, the NJ District 19 Host Champs on August 8.

Congratulations to Past Eastern Regional Champions
2009 - Holbrook LL (New Jersey)
2008 - Canton LL (Massachusetts)
2007 - Middletown LL (NJ D19-Host)
2006 - North Cumberland LL (NJ State Champs)
2005 - Freehold Twp. LL (NJ D19-Host)
* Above Winners for Regional's Held at Freehold Twp. Only *
